  • Advanced+Chipless+RFID

    The author’s group has developed various chipless RFID tags and reader architectures at 2.45, 4–8, 24, and 60 GHz. These results were published extensively in the form of books, book chapters, refereed conference and journal articles, and finally, as patent applications. However, there is still room for improvement of chipless RFID sys- TEMS. In this book, we proposed advanced techniques of chipless RFID sysTEMS that supersede their predecessors in signal processing, tag design, and reader architecture.

  • 高效率射頻微波固態(tài)功率放大器

    Research on microwave power amplififiers has gained a growing importance demanded by the many continuously developing applications which require such subsystem performance. A broad set of commercial and strategic sysTEMS in fact have their overall performance boosted by the power amplififier, the latter becoming an enabling component wherever its effificiency and output power actually allows functionalities and operating modes previously not possible. This is the case for the many wireless sysTEMS and battery-operated sysTEMS that form the substrate of everyday life, but also of high-performance satellite and dual-use sysTEMS.
